O.C.G.A. 22-3-85 (2010)
22-3-85. Procedure for hearings and appeals


All hearings and appeals on applications for certificates and permits required under this article shall be conducted in accordance with Chapter 13 of Title 50, the "Georgia Administrative Procedure Act," provided that if the final decision of the Administrative Law Judge on any appeal is not rendered within 120 days from the date of filing of a petition for review, the decision of the director shall be affirmed by operation of law; and provided further that judicial review of the approval or denial of an application under Code Section 22-3-84 shall be governed by Code Section 12-2-1.
